Mayer Hersh MBE (31 August 1926 – 8 October 2016) was a Polish Jew who survived the Auschwitz concentration camp. [1] Born in Sieradz to a family of six siblings, only Mayer and his brother Jakob survived. [2] [3] his father, mother and three other siblings were murdered in Chełmno extermination camp.
After
World War II, Hersh lived in
Manchester, England.
[4] He was awarded an
MBE in the
2013 New Year Honours for services to
Holocaust education.
[5]
[6]
Mayer died on 8 October 2016, at the age of 90.
